Jason Rhoades: The Big Picture
"The Big Picture" documents "Perfect World," a 1999 installation that Jason Rhoades (1965-2006) created for the Deichtorhallen in Hamburg-an installation regarded by many as his most important project. This publication examines the work through photographs of "Perfect World"'s 1999 and 2000 iterations and its posthumous exhibition at Hauser & Wirth in 2010, when it was shown complete for the first time.

Jason Langer

Jason Langer

Kerber Verlag
2022
sidottu
Jason Langer (*1967) lived on a kibbutz in Israel from the age of six to eleven, formative years which have shaped him to this day, so when he was invited to Berlin in 2008 to photograph the city, he met the suggestion with trepidation. Associating the German capital with its 20th century atrocities, he saw it as a cold, unfriendly place. Even so he accepted, and from 2009-2013 he explored the city mostly on foot, with two film cameras and black and white film. He photographed Berlin with an eye towards places where Jewish people were deported or killed but also took it as an opportunity to confront and update his preconceived notions and find a new narrative of contemporary Germany and the German people. Photographing the streets, people he met on the way, and acquaintances who grew to be friends, he tracked traces of the Holocaust, the Cold War, and imagined the freedom and creative expression of the roaring '20s.
Jason Schmidt

Jason Schmidt

Christopher Bollen

Steidl Verlag
2015
sidottu
Artists II is the second volume of Jason Schmidt's ongoing photographic documentation of today's most significant artists. From young to old creative forces, emerging to career-peaking, world-famous or as yet unknown, Schmidt's images, captured over a period of twelve years, are an incisive look into the art world of today. Artists II depicts 166 artists, including John Baldessari, Ai Weiwei, Glenn Ligon and Cindy Sherman, in their studios or work environments, showing the practitioners in their most intimate moments--in the process of creation. A revealing text by each artist accompanies his or her portrait; some are literal descriptions of the encounter, others are poetic or enigmatic. Situated between portraiture and landscape, Schmidt's photographs show art and artist in constant transformation, and form a comprehensive archive of contemporary artistic practice.
Jason Rhoades: Illastrations

Jason Rhoades: Illastrations

Jason Rhoades

Hauser Wirth
2025
sidottu
A glimpse inside the mind of Jason Rhoades, through a facsimile edition of the visionary artist’s sketchbook Illastrations is a facsimile of an undated sketchbook of drawings by Jason Rhoades that he and his wife, the artist Rachel Khedoori, gifted to their friend and patron Iwan Wirth. A leading figure of the 1990s international art world, Rhoades was a world builder, an outlier. Like his art, the book is a dynamic construction designed to systematically explore and communicate life’s big questions. It serves as a guide to Rhoades’s visionary work: a collection of didactic cartoons, organized by keyword, that illustrate key concepts, materials, works of art, and personal references, including “abstraction,” “curator,” “donut,” “Marcel Duchamp,” “unfair.” Presented in a slipcase and bound as what feels like an art supply sketchbook, Illastrations is an object to treasure, encapsulating the playfulness of a Californian cowboy who never relinquished his sense of punk practicality.

Jason med det gyldne Skind

Jason med det gyldne Skind

Vilhelm Topsøe

Gyldendal Trade 140
2010
sidottu
Vilhelm Topsøe: Jason med det gyldne Skind (udgivet af Johan de Mylius) Det var med romanen "Jason med det gyldne Skind" (1875), at en ny tid og en ny tids mennesker for alvor trådte ind på litteraturens scene. Forfatteren var anonym, men hans navn var Vilhelm Topsøe (1840-81), i samtiden kendt som chefredaktør for og medindehaver af den største danske avis, "Dagbladet". Med denne roman rettedes søgelyset mod nye mennesketyper: de såkaldte nervøse, »trætte« mænd, der kom til at præge litteraturen op mod århundredskiftet, mod rovdyrinstinktet, der kræver sin ret i pengenes og seksualitetens sfære, mod det praktiske arbejde (hovedpersonen er oprindeligt mediciner, men gør sin lykke i Indien som ingeniør), mod den borgerlige fremdrift og selvhævdelse over for adel og gamle privilegier, og på det indre plan er der særligt fokus på instinktet og det ubevidste sjæleliv, de små, umærkelige tilskyndelser med de store konsekvenser. I skrivemåden ses i flere partier af romanen tydelige forstadier til den impressionisme, som Herman Bang senere skulle raffinere. Men så moderne romanen end var, blev den udstødt i mørket af den kulturradikale fløj. Da Georg Brandes i 1883 udgav "Det moderne Gennembruds Mænd", var Topsøe og hans roman ikke med her. Topsøe var som reformkonservativ politisk bandlyst i Det Moderne Gennembrud, og det har præget hele eftertidens behandling af romanen. Den var først på pletten, men den blev udstødt af det gode selskab. Det er en 'litteratur-historie', der bør revurderes. - et værk i den ambitiøse serie Danske Klassikere, der udgives af Det Danske Sprog- og Litteraturselskab og relanceres af Gyldendal.
